The major drivers in the global non-woven adhesives market are the skyrocketing requirement for these products in the textile sector, growing awareness about better quality products, and surging demand for these adhesives in adult incontinence, baby care, and feminine hygiene applications. The market will grow at a significant pace in the coming years. However, the outbreak of COVID-19 had disrupted several markets and this market was not an exception. Lockdowns were imposed in several economies amid the pandemic rupturing the logistical network of the market owing to the complete or partial manufacturing unit closures. 

Within the type segment, the amorphous poly alpha olefin category will spur the non-woven adhesives market growth. This can be ascribed to its compatibility in all slot and spray applications because this category possesses exceptional processability. Moreover, it not only provides aversion against solvents and acid, including several greases and lubricants but also is highly cost-effective, which in turn, fuels the requirement of industrial types of machinery.
